Geoffrey Wong, M.D., FACS, part of Hackensack Meridian Medical Group, has been named the central regional chair of Vascular Surgery. Dr. Wong is a highly experienced vascular surgeon with 20 years dedicated to the field of vascular medicine and surgery. He has a proven track record of outstanding results in the management of a wide range of conditions, including carotid disease, aortic aneurysm, peripheral vascular disease, venous disease, and non-healing wounds. His clinical expertise encompasses a broad spectrum of advanced procedures, including complex open and endovascular aortic repairs, carotid interventions, peripheral bypasses, and advanced wound care. In addition to his clinical practice as President of Garden State Surgical PA, he holds significant leadership roles as the Division Chief of Vascular Surgery, Vice Chair of Surgery, and Director of the Vascular Verification Program at JFK UMC. His commitment to advancing the field is further demonstrated through his positions as an Assistant Clinical Professor of Surgery at the HMH School of Medicine and a faculty member of the American College of Surgeons.
